Booyah float past Rafters

The Green Bay Booyah scored single runs in consecutive innings en route to a 6-2 win over the Wisconsin Rapids Rafters on Sunday.

 

The scoring started in the second inning when the Booyah took advantage of an error and drove in Johnny Hipsman on a double by Tyler Hollow. Jake Berg drove in a run in the third inning and Preston Hall homered in the fourth to make it 3-0 after four. The Booyah tacked on two more in the sixth inning on consecutive RBI singles by  Hollow and Nick Dagnello. The Booyah would give up a run in the seventh and trade runs with the Rafters in the ninth when their RBI single by Dayson Croes was answered in the bottom half of the inning.
